About the Role:
The CNC Lathe Machinist plays a critical role in the manufacturing process by operating and programming computer numerical control (CNC) lathes to produce precision parts and components. This position requires a deep understanding of machining techniques, materials, and tooling to ensure that all products meet stringent quality and specification standards. The machinist will collaborate closely with engineering and quality assurance teams to interpret technical drawings and optimize machining processes. Attention to detail and adherence to safety protocols are paramount to maintain a safe and efficient work environment. Ultimately, the role contributes directly to the company’s ability to deliver high-quality products on time and within budget.

Responsibilities:
- Set up, operate, and maintain CNC lathe machines to manufacture precision parts according to engineering specifications.
- Read and interpret blueprints, technical drawings, and CAD/CAM programs to determine machining operations and sequences.
- Perform routine inspections and measurements using precision instruments to ensure parts meet quality standards.
- Adjust machine settings and tooling as necessary to optimize production efficiency and part accuracy.
- Maintain accurate production records and report any issues or deviations to supervisors promptly.
- Collaborate with maintenance personnel to troubleshoot and resolve mechanical or programming issues.
- Adhere strictly to all safety guidelines and maintain a clean and organized work area.
Skills:
The CNC Lathe Machinist utilizes technical skills daily to set up and operate complex machinery, ensuring parts are produced to exact specifications. Proficiency in reading blueprints and CAD drawings allows the machinist to accurately interpret design requirements and translate them into precise machining operations. Measuring and inspection skills are essential to verify part quality and maintain consistency throughout production runs. Programming knowledge enhances the ability to optimize machine performance and reduce downtime by adjusting CNC parameters effectively. Additionally, strong communication and problem-solving skills facilitate collaboration with team members and quick resolution of any operational challenges.
